Summary
Ricky Hatton, a former world champion boxer, was found dead at his home at age 46, with police ruling out suspicious circumstances. His son, Campbell Hatton, expressed deep sadness and shared his admiration for his father on social media. Ricky Hatton was known for his successful career, winning 45 of 48 professional fights.
Key Facts
- Ricky Hatton, a former world champion boxer, has died at the age of 46.
- He was found at his home in Hyde, Greater Manchester, with no suspicious circumstances.
- Ricky Hatton won 45 of his 48 professional boxing matches.
- He was a world champion in the light-welterweight and welterweight divisions.
- A large fan base followed him, including 30,000 fans to his 2007 fight against Floyd Mayweather.
- His son, Campbell Hatton, also a professional boxer, retired earlier this year after winning 14 fights.
- Campbell posted an emotional tribute to his father on Instagram.
- Ricky Hatton had planned to return to the boxing ring in October.
